A well-crafted social media presence can be a game-changer. Connect with your target audience on platforms where they hang out, share valuable content, and utilize paid campaigns to reach new customers. Consider partnering with popular bloggers who can help you build brand awareness.
Don't underestimate the power of word-of-mouth marketing. Encourage happy customers to leave positive reviews online and spread the word about your business. Offer referral programs that motivate people to recommend your business with their friends and family.

Elevate Your Local Presence: Local Marketing Tips for Small Businesses
Building a strong local presence is crucial for small businesses looking to thrive. In today's digital age, there are numerous opportunities to connect with your target audience. Here are some essential local marketing tips to help you grow your business:
* **Improve Your Google My Business Listing:** This is a fundamental step for any local business. Ensure your listing is complete with your business name, address, phone number, hours of operation, and relevant descriptions.
* **Utilize Social Media:** Connect with your community on platforms like Facebook, Instagram, and Twitter. Share engaging content that showcases your business, products or services, and showcases your unique value proposition.
* **Participate in Local Events:** This is a fantastic way to enhance brand awareness and foster relationships with your potential clients.
